You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ignite.apache.org by ak...@apache.org on 2015/09/05 04:28:15 UTC

ignite git commit: IGNITE-843 Added chart settings btn.

Repository: ignite
Updated Branches:
  refs/heads/ignite-843 771787523 -> e5eede56b


IGNITE-843 Added chart settings btn.


Project: http://git-wip-us.apache.org/repos/asf/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/e5eede56
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/e5eede56
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/e5eede56

Branch: refs/heads/ignite-843
Commit: e5eede56b90997218cf6212db941fcecfa246012
Parents: 7717875
Author: AKuznetsov <ak...@gridgain.com>
Authored: Sat Sep 5 09:28:14 2015 +0700
Committer: AKuznetsov <ak...@gridgain.com>
Committed: Sat Sep 5 09:28:14 2015 +0700

----------------------------------------------------------------------
 .../src/main/js/controllers/common-module.js              | 10 +++++-----
 .../src/main/js/public/stylesheets/style.scss             |  5 +++++
 modules/control-center-web/src/main/js/views/sql/sql.jade |  3 ++-
 3 files changed, 12 insertions(+), 6 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ignite/blob/e5eede56/modules/control-center-web/src/main/js/controllers/common-module.js
----------------------------------------------------------------------
diff --git a/modules/control-center-web/src/main/js/controllers/common-module.js b/modules/control-center-web/src/main/js/controllers/common-module.js
index bf1f6ec..99d902f 100644
--- a/modules/control-center-web/src/main/js/controllers/common-module.js
+++ b/modules/control-center-web/src/main/js/controllers/common-module.js
@@ -1341,13 +1341,13 @@ controlCenterModule.factory('$focus', function ($timeout) {
 });
 
 // Directive to auto-focus element.
-controlCenterModule.directive('autoFocus', function() {
+controlCenterModule.directive('autoFocus', function($timeout) {
     return {
-        link: {
-            post: function postLink(scope, element) {
-                // this succeeds since the element has been rendered
+        restrict: 'AC',
+        link: function(scope, element) {
+            $timeout(function(){
                 element[0].focus();
-            }
+            });
         }
     };
 });

http://git-wip-us.apache.org/repos/asf/ignite/blob/e5eede56/modules/control-center-web/src/main/js/public/stylesheets/style.scss
----------------------------------------------------------------------
diff --git a/modules/control-center-web/src/main/js/public/stylesheets/style.scss b/modules/control-center-web/src/main/js/public/stylesheets/style.scss
index fed7ce3..fb88969 100644
--- a/modules/control-center-web/src/main/js/public/stylesheets/style.scss
+++ b/modules/control-center-web/src/main/js/public/stylesheets/style.scss
@@ -1253,6 +1253,11 @@ a {
     }
 }
 
+.chart-btn {
+    position: absolute;
+    right: 30px;
+}
+
 .loading-indicator {
     box-sizing: border-box;
     -webkit-box-sizing: border-box;

http://git-wip-us.apache.org/repos/asf/ignite/blob/e5eede56/modules/control-center-web/src/main/js/views/sql/sql.jade
----------------------------------------------------------------------
diff --git a/modules/control-center-web/src/main/js/views/sql/sql.jade b/modules/control-center-web/src/main/js/views/sql/sql.jade
index 75878be..7650aee 100644
--- a/modules/control-center-web/src/main/js/views/sql/sql.jade
+++ b/modules/control-center-web/src/main/js/views/sql/sql.jade
@@ -62,7 +62,7 @@ block container
                                     .btn-group(ng-model='paragraph.result' ng-click='$event.stopPropagation()' style='float: right')
                                         +btn-toolbar-data('fa-table', 'table', 'Show data in tabular form.')
                                         +btn-toolbar-data('fa-bar-chart', 'bar', 'Show bar chart.<br/>By default first column - X values, second column - Y values.<br/>In case of one column it will be treated as Y values.')
-                                        +btn-toolbar-data('fa-pie-chart', 'pie', 'Show pie chart.<br/>By default first column - pie values, second column - pie labels.<br/>In case of one column it will be treated as pies values.')
+                                        +btn-toolbar-data('fa-pie-chart', 'pie', 'Show pie chart.<br/>By default first column - pie values, second column - pie labels.<br/>In case of one column it will be treated as pie values.')
                                         +btn-toolbar-data('fa-line-chart', 'line', 'Show line chart.<br/>By default first column - X values, second column - Y values.<br/>In case of one column it will be treated as Y values.')
                                         +btn-toolbar-data('fa-area-chart', 'area', 'Show area chart.<br/>By default first column - X values, second column - Y values.<br/>In case of one column it will be treated as Y values.')
                                 div(ng-show='paragraph.edit')
@@ -114,6 +114,7 @@ block container
                                                 tr(ng-repeat='row in displayedCollection track by $index')
                                                     td(ng-repeat='val in row track by $index') {{ val }}
                                 .panel-body(ng-show='paragraph.rows && paragraph.result != "table" && paragraph.result != "none"')
+                                    +btn-toolbar('chart-btn fa-cog', 'console.log("zzz")', 'Chart settings')
                                     div(id='chart-{{paragraph.id}}')
                                         svg
                                 .panel-body(ng-show='!paragraph.rows')